Nick Diaz is officially off the hook in his felony domestic violence case ... at least, according to the UFC star's attorney.

As we previously reported ... Diaz was arrested back in May after a woman claimed he slammed her to the ground and choked her in a Las Vegas home.

When cops arrived, officers say the woman had injuries -- she was transported to a nearby hospital for treatment.

Diaz was facing 3 felony domestic violence charges and a misdemeanor -- serious business.

But now, Diaz's attorney Ross Goodman has told ESPN ... prosecutors have thrown out the case and Nick is in the clear.

"[Nick is] grateful the District Attorney's office was fair and thoughtful in reviewing this case based on the evidence," Goodman said to ESPN.

"Truth delayed is better than no truth at all and I trust that the ultimate dismissal of all charges with prejudice will be viewed as total vindication for Nick and clears his name from being associated with such horrific but false allegations."

Ex-NFL star Greg Lloyd was arrested in Georgia after allegedly pulling a gun on his wife and threatening to shoot her during a domestic dispute, but Greg vehemently denies the allegations.

According to official documents -- obtained by TMZ Sports -- Greg's wife, Stephanie Lloyd, told police ... the ex-Steelers linebacker pointed a gun at her at their home on July 20, and "told me that if I f**k up I'm going to get one."

Stephanie says she managed to get in her car and leave the house -- but Greg called her on the phone and continued making threats.

"Doing stupid sh*t like this is how you end up in the morgue," Greg allegedly said.

Stephanie claims Greg insisted his gun was not loaded -- but she's scared nonetheless.

Stephanie filed for a restraining order against Greg, saying, "I have battled all types of abuse from my husband for years hoping that things would at some point get better ... I do not feel safe anymore."

Stephanie claims Greg "has a history of pointing guns at other people but this is the first time for me."

Court records show Lloyd was convicted of pointing a gun at another person back in the early 2000s. We're working on the details from that case.

53-year-old Lloyd was arrested on July 27, 2018 for felony aggravated assault and misdemeanor pointing a gun at another person, according to official records. He was released 3 days later.

Court docs also show Stephanie's restraining order was granted -- and Greg has been ordered to stay at least 200 yards away from her until August 2019.

We spoke with Lloyd, who denies any wrongdoing ... and says he'll let due process take its course.

Lloyd was a stud linebacker back in the '90s -- a 5-time Pro Bowler, 3-time All-Pro and was named to the Steelers' All-Time Team.

LB Mychal Kendricks Cut by Browns After Insider Trading Charges

Published | Updated

White collar crime doesn't sit well with the Browns -- the team just released linebacker Mychal Kendricks in the wake of his insider trading charges.

Kendricks has admitted to breaking federal laws by trading perks for tips in a scheme to make an ill-gotten fortune. Officials say Kendricks turned $80k into roughly $1.2 million using private information that wasn't available to the public.

Kendricks issued a public apology for his role in the scheme -- accepting blame and saying he's ready to deal with the consequences.

Those consequences could be steep -- he's facing serious prison time if convicted. And, since he's already confessed, he'll almost certainly be convicted. Clearly, the Browns want no part of his legal drama and decided to simply cut bait Wednesday.

Kendricks was a member of the Philadelphia Eagles' Super Bowl winning team last season, and was expected to be a big part of the Browns' D in 2018.

Ex-pro tennis player Anne White says she knows how Serena Williams feels about the ban on her catsuit at the French Open .. because she went through the exact same thing back in the '80s.

White famously wore a body suit to play in Wimbledon in 1985 -- but was told during the tournament, the suit violated the dress code and she needed to change it or she couldn't continue.

She changed her outfit -- and lost the following match.

White tells TMZ Sports she felt the whole thing was sexist -- "It's kinda crazy that women aren't allowed to wear what they want to work. It's a shame."

Like Serena, Anne says her catsuit was more about function than fashion -- explaining her outfit was intended to keep her warm in the cold weather.

FYI, Serena's catsuit was custom-designed to increase blood circulation in the wake of health issues caused by blot clots.

White tells us ... she's a HUGE fan of Serena and believes tennis officials should change the rules to allow women like Williams to essentially wear whatever they want, especially if there's a legit reason.

There are other critics who think the ban on Serena's catsuit was racially motivated. It seems Anne believes it's not just about black and white ... it's about women still getting the short end of the stick in a "man's world."
